The ingredients needed to make Sprouted Foxtail millet/Thinai laddu:
  1. Make ready 1 cup Foxtail millets
  2. Make ready 1/4 cup split Moong dal
  3. Take 1 cup Jaggery
  4. Take 6 Green Cardamom
  5. Make ready 1/4 cup Water
  6. Get 1 tbsp Ghee
  7. Get 2 tbsp Nuts of choice, chopped
Instructions to make Sprouted Foxtail millet/Thinai laddu:

  2. Soak Foxtail millet for 4 hours to overnight. Next day drain water & tap dry. Tie it in a cotton cloth to sprout.
  3. Once sprouted, dry roast it in a pan until slightly browned. Keep the flame in medium.
  4. Wash Moong dal & pat dry. Dry roast it until browned.
  5. Grind roasted millets & dal to fine powder with green cardamom in a blender. Remove the skin & add only seeds of green cardamom. Sieve flour if needed.
  6. Make jaggery syrup with jaggery & water. No need of any consistency, set aside once jaggery dissolves.
  7. In a pan, add Ghee & fry the chopped nuts. Then add the powdered flour & roast for 2 mins.
  8. Switch off flame & add the Jaggery syrup & mix well. Add ghee if needed.
  9. Let it cool for sometime & make round ladoos out of this mixture. Add ghee if the flour is too dry.
